Walt Disney World has revealed an impressive lineup of performers for this year's Garden Rocks Concert Series at the 2024 EPCOT International Flower & Garden Festival.

Rock out to the songs you love during the Garden Rocks Concert Series at the EPCOT International Flower & Garden Festival.
This year’s festival will begin on Feb. 28 and continue through May 27 for 90 days full of beautiful topiaries, inspirational gardens, delicious dishes and rockin’ music celebrating spring.
Walt Disney World has already revealed that this year's festival will feature more than 70 topiaries, including new topiaries from the Walt Disney Animation Studios film “Wish,” including Asha, Valentino and the Wishing Star, will feature at the park’s main entrance, find out all the details on this years topiaries and gardens here.
Now onto the music! It’s time to dance and sing along to your favorites as the popular Garden Rocks concert series takes to the American Gardens Theatre stage daily during the festival.
Featuring local and globally recognized acts, there’s something for everyone. this year, the festival welcome many new groups, including Modern English, Crowder, Lit, and Monsieur Perine. And for the first time, Raul Acosta & Oro Solido will share the stage with Magic Juan, then return the next day with Luisito Ayala and The Puerto Rican Power Band in a series of unforgettable performances.

Full 2024 Garden Rocks Concert Series Lineup
The Vybe | February 28 and 29
Jason Scheff | March 1 and 2
Richard Marx | March 3 and 4
Evolution Motown | March 5, 6 and 7
Berlin | March 8 and 9
Rick Springfield | March 10 and 11
Dian Diaz | March 12, 13 and 14
Modern English (NEW) | March 15 and 16
Commodores | March 17 and 18
Foreigners Journey | March 19, 20 and 21
The Orchestra | March 22, 23, 24 and 25
The Female Collective | March 26, 27 and 28
Mike DelGuidice | March 29 and 30
Pointer Sisters | March 31 and April 1
Funkafied | April 2, 3 and 4
Blue October | April 5 and 6
Crowder (NEW) | April 7 and 8
Hooligans | April 9, 10 and 11
Jo Dee Messina | April 12 and 13
A Flock of Seagulls | April 14 and 15
M-80’s | April 16, 17 and 18
Plain White T’s | April 19, 20, 21 and 22
Champagne Orchestra | April 23, 24 and 25
Starship Featuring Mickey Thomas | April 26 and 27
Herman’s Hermits Starring Peter Noone | April 28 and 29
Southbound | April 30 and May 1, 2
Monsieur Periné | May 3
Raul Acosta & Oro Solido with Magic Juan | May 4
Raul Acosta & Oro Solido with Luisito Ayala and The Puerto Rican Power Band | May 5
To Be Announced | May 6
Gilly & The Girl Band | May 7, 8 and 9
Simple Plan | May 10, 11, 12 and 13
Element | May 14, 15 and 16
The Spinners | May 17 and 18
To Be Announced | May 19 and 20
Epic | May 21, 22 and 23
Lit (NEW) | May 24 and 25
To Be Announced | May 26 and 27
Garden Rocks Dining Packages Open Feb. 6
To guarantee priority seating for your preferred performances, be sure to check out Dining Packages, available at seven fabulous EPCOT restaurants:
Akershus Royal Banquet Hall
Biergarten Restaurant
Coral Reef Restaurant
Garden Grill Restaurant
Rose & Crown Dining Room
Le Cellier Steakhouse
Regal Eagle Smokehouse: Craft Brews & Barbecue (same-day, in-person walk-up packages only)
For more information, including pricing and availability, visit DisneyWorld.com. Packages go on sale beginning Feb. 6.
